Shoes

  • If you live in northern parts of the U.S. then there’s no escaping the need for rugged winter boots that keep little toes toasty warm - starting at the toddler stage. Waterproof boots with grippy soles and insulated liners will help keep your child comfortable and safe during walks from the car to the classroom and beyond.
  • Everyday shoes should be sturdy enough to provide support and comfortable enough for all day wear indoors and outdoors. Most parents opt for a lace-up tennis shoe that can be worn with jeans and most other types of casual outfits. 

Winter Coats

  • A reliable winter jacket is crucial for surviving the coldest months of the year, no matter how well you’ve layered your children’s clothes underneath. Basic features to look for include a water resistant outer shell, and insulated interior, a hood, and ample pocket storage space for phones and other items they you kids might want quickly accessible.

Rain Coat

  • We know all too well that no matter where you live, the Fall and Spring seasons are likely to bring rain. Keep your kids dry and comfortable with a jacket that will repel the rain and provide some warmth during those chilly outdoor walks or sideline soccer game cheering sessions.
